"In compliance with the will of his father-in-law, the Rev. J.
T. F. Hurt, his wife, and their issue - five sons and three daughters
- assumed by Royal sign manual, 15 Sept., 1827, the surname of Wolley only, and
also the arms of Wolley. He died in November, 1877, and was succeeded by his
third son, Charles, born 21 March, 1826, now the Rev. Charles Wolley-Dod, of
Edge Hall, Malpas, co. Chester, whose wife was the granddaughter of T. C. Dod,
Esq., of Edge Hall, whose surname he has since assumed. He has had issue eight
sons and three daughters, the eldest and heir being Francis, born 3 May, 1854,
married 1887, to Annette, daughter of F. Clark, Esq., of Aldridge Lodge, co.
Stafford, by whom there is issue, John Cadogan, Charles, and a daughter."
The change of surname referred to above was published in the London
Gazette. Adam Wolley's name appears frequently in early 19th century
issues and in 1821 he is listed as the heir to his late brother, John.

Notes on the published pedigree:
- There is a misprint in the information
about Adam Wolley and his wife Grace who died in 1657 and 1669
respectively. They were married for 76 years, not 26 as printed.
See a transcript of their MI in Matlock church
- Whilst researching Charles Clarke, the son-in-law of Adam Wolley,
the web mistress came across three different dates for his death.
Bryan says it was 15 Apr 1863 as shown above and in his book. The
MI transcripts on this site say
it was the 13th April and "The
Derby Mercury", publishing the announcement of his death
on the Wednesday 15th Apr stated he died on Sunday 12th April.
